Best place to see a Bollywood flick in India
Even if you don’t understand a word of Hindi, it’s worth taking in a flick to soak up some Bollywood glam. The Raj Mandir cinema in , is perhaps the best-known cinema in and can seat up to 1,237 moviegoers.
Opened in 1976, the cinema was designed in Art Moderne style (which is essentially late Art Deco) by architect W.M. Namjoshi and is, rather oddly, shaped like a meringue in pastel hues.
Over the years, this Indian icon has hosted many Bollywood premieres. And walking inside the grand foyer, you’ll get a sense of its once-glorious past, with chandeliers in a domed ceiling and a ramp that sweeps you up to the balconies. Nowadays, however, multiplex theatres are popping up all over India and replacing the Art Deco theatres as the place to see and be seen. But the Raj Mandir still manages to pack in a crowd.
Even without subtitles, a Bollywood flick can be just as much a cultural experience as visiting a temple or museum. You can book a ticket from one hour up to seven days in advance at Windows 7 or 8 (between 10am to 6pm), or stand in line when the ticket booth opens 45 minutes before the show.
Cost: Tickets cost between Rs90 to Rs150 (balcony seats are more expensive)
Address: Raj Mandir, B-16 Bhagwan Das Road C-Scheme, Jaipur, Rajhasthan
